ABA insurance & Medicaid coverage in Vermont

Vermont's Medicaid program, Green Mountain Care, covers ABA therapy for eligible children under the early and periodic screening, diagnostic, and treatment (EPSDT) benefit. Most private insurers in Vermont also offer ABA coverage following the state's autism insurance mandate, though specifics can vary by plan.

What ages do ABA providers near Hinesburg serve?

Most providers in Chittenden County serve children from early childhood (as young as 18 months) through age 18 or 21. Some programs focus on specific age groups, so we'll match you with providers who specialize in your child's developmental stage.
